Social behavior can indeed benefit the individual in various ways, such as enhancing cooperation, providing emotional support, and increasing access to resources. While there may be instances where social behavior seems to come at a personal cost, overall, it often leads to improved survival and reproductive success. Additionally, engaging in social interactions can foster alliances and improve one's status within a group, further promoting individual well-being. Therefore, social behavior typically offers significant advantages to individuals.
